WebMay 14, 2024 · Floodplain overlay districts requirements must comply with state Wetlands Protection Act Regulations. Compensatory storage is required for Bordering Land Subject to Flooding (310 CMR 10.57 (4)), which is in the FEMA SFHA. Several communities have adopted additional requirements. Dedham requires a 2:1 ratio of compensatory storage. WebSUMMARY.
